Ok, being a nerd I watched some demos from hslan. Generally the way to succeed is pushing for church -> outskirts. The western outskirts flag is hard to hold and attacking up the hill through MG and PAK crossfire is very hard. It is best to establish a foothold at the other flags and then get west when the Germans are preoccupied with fighting in the city.

Actually...

- Almost all armoured vehicles are mentioned in the data used for this map. Not in the way they are used in-game but Imo that’s acceptable.
- The British have a mg42 at one of their bases as a reference to the captured equipment. Maybe some pickup kits could be added.
- This map is too small for planes.
- If I’m not mistaken the British commander has smoke artillery (combined with the regular).
